Apple Patents AirPods with Advanced Biosensors for Health Monitoring

Apple has been granted a patent for AirPods with biosensors to monitor various biosignals, according to the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office. The patent, titled ‘Biosignal Sensing Device Using Dynamic Selection of Electrodes,’ describes a wearable device for measuring a user’s biological signals, including but not limited to electroencephalography (EEG), electromyography (EMG), and electrooculography (EOG).

Federal Court Dismisses X’s Data Scraping Claims

A federal court in California dismissed the lawsuit filed by X (formerly Twitter) against Israeli company Bright Data, after finding that X failed to prove its claims of breach of contract. Microsoft Unveils First Annual Responsible AI Transparency Report

Microsoft released its first annual Responsible AI Transparency Report, offering insights into the company’s ethical AI efforts. The report explains how Microsoft builds generative AI applications, determines their release, supports customers in responsible AI use, and evolves its AI practices.

Council of Europe Adopts First International Treaty on AI and Human Rights

The Council of Europe has adopted the first international, legally binding treaty to ensure human rights, the rule of law, and democratic standards in the use of artificial intelligence (AI) systems. EU Designates Booking.com as Gatekeeper Under the Digital Markets Act

On May 13, 2024, the European Commission announced that it has designated Booking.com as a gatekeeper under the Digital Markets Act (DMA) for its online intermediation service. However, the Commission decided not to designate X Ads and TikTok Ads as gatekeepers.

Israeli Bar Association’s Ethical Guidelines on Using AI

On May 7, 2024, the National Ethics Committee of the Israeli Bar Association published guidelines on lawyers’ use of artificial intelligence (AI). The opinion outlines the risks and provides recommendations for ethical AI use in legal practice, considering the growing interest in AI tools like ChatGPT by OpenAI, Copilot by Microsoft, and Gemini by Google.
